This is the layout I made for the challenge at Scrappassion. You had to use this sketch and a screenprint:

Because I had never worked with screenprints and I didn't have them in my supplies I decided to make them myself!...I stamped some flowers on several clear sheets and drew a line around the flowers with a black marker.
I liked the results so much, so I made the complete sketch with these home-made sheets.
Than I added some Prima-flowers and a title with Thickers.

Challenge at The Heart of Scrap

The messageboard of TheHeartOfScrap started his first challenge this month: use ribbon and/or fabric, paint and a non-scrap-item and make a cool layout!
I used clothing-labels ( Is this a good english word?? I meant the designer-labels which come together with the price-labels when you buy clothes!) not only as a non-scrap-item but also because of the fabric. The left one was originally green, so I painted it with white acrylic paint and made some black lines with my marker. I also added some ribbon and some flowers. The silver flower came from a decoration on a yoghurt-package!
The right one was a grey cardboard label, which I painted also and stamped some words on it.
Because it had to be a cool(tough?) layout I didn't want to add much flowers. I think the picture also speaks for itself and doesn't 'ask' for flowers...So I added some plastic spiders!
